Output ee343175daf99f10eab7311cd1545854613e270b97e5d1b6e3f478c4fb58c785:2

value
15685
script pubkey
OP_0 OP_PUSHBYTES_20 0ab15c3fdee69a4e5d560c0a143798dd331234e0
address
tb1qp2c4c077u6dyuh2kps9pgducm5e3yd8qdalgad
transaction
ee343175daf99f10eab7311cd1545854613e270b97e5d1b6e3f478c4fb58c785